Proxy

  • Lisa Fröhlich
  • November 23, 2023

Inhaltsverzeichnis

    Proxy

    Ein Proxy ist ein Server, der als Vermittler zwischen einem Endgerät, wie einem Computer, und dem Internet fungiert. Wenn ein Gerät eine Internetverbindung über einen Proxy-Server aufbaut, sendet dieser die Anfragen an den Zielserver und leitet die Antworten zurück an das Endgerät.

    Was genau macht ein Proxy-Server?

    Ein Proxy Server kann dabei unterschiedliche Funktionen haben. Er kann beispielsweise die IP-Adresse des Benutzers verbergen, was dessen Anonymität im Internet erhöht. Websites und Dienste erkennen nur die IP-Adresse des Proxys und nicht die des ursprünglichen Benutzers. Ein Proxy kann außerdem als Sicherheitsfilter dienen, um bösartigen Datenverkehr zu blockieren, bevor er das Netzwerk eines Unternehmens oder eines Endgeräts erreicht.

    In Unternehmensnetzwerken werden sie oft eingesetzt, um den Internetzugang zu regulieren und zu kontrollieren, welche Websites und Dienste von Mitarbeitern genutzt werden können. Proxys können häufig angeforderte Daten zwischenspeichern, um die Ladegeschwindigkeit zu verbessern und die Bandbreitennutzung zu reduzieren, da identische Inhalte nicht jedes Mal neu geladen werden müssen.

    Ein Proxy mit einem Standort in einem bestimmten Land kann verwendet werden, um regionale Beschränkungen und Zensur zu umgehen.

    Wie funktioniert ein Proxy-Server?

    Wenn ein Benutzer im Internet auf eine Website oder Ressource zugreifen möchte, sendet sein Gerät zuerst eine Anfrage an den Proxy-Server. Der Proxy-Server empfängt diese Anfrage. Anstatt sie direkt an die Zielwebsite zu senden, nimmt dieser die Anfrage entgegen und leitet sie im Namen des Benutzers weiter. Dabei kann der Proxy die Anfragedaten ändern, beispielsweise die IP-Adresse des Benutzers verbergen, um dessen Anonymität zu wahren.

    Wenn der Server bereits zuvor eine ähnliche Anfrage bearbeitet hat und die angeforderten Daten zwischengespeichert hat, kann er diese Daten direkt an den Benutzer zurücksenden, ohne die Anfrage weiterzuleiten. Dies verbessert die Ladegeschwindigkeit und reduziert die Bandbreitennutzung.

    Falls der Proxy die Daten nicht zwischengespeichert hat, leitet er die Anfrage an die entsprechende Website oder den entsprechenden Dienst weiter. Die Zielwebsite verarbeitet die Anfrage und sendet eine Antwort zurück an den Proxy-Server. Der Proxy-Server empfängt die Antwort der Zielwebsite.

    Er kann diese Antwort überprüfen, modifizieren (beispielsweise Werbung entfernen oder Sicherheitschecks durchführen) und leitet sie dann an das Benutzergerät weiter. Der Benutzer erhält die Antwort von der Website, als wäre sie direkt von der Website gekommen, obwohl sie tatsächlich durch den Proxy-Server vermittelt wurde.

    Welche Arten von Proxy Servern gibt es?

    Es gibt verschiedene Arten von Proxy Servern mit unterschiedlichen Datenschutzniveaus. Jeder Proxy-Typ hat seine spezifischen Anwendungsfälle und bietet verschiedene Grade von Anonymität, Sicherheit und Funktionalität. Beispiele für Arten von Proxy-Servern sind:

    1. Transparente Proxys leiten Anfragen weiter, ohne die IP-Adresse des Nutzers zu ändern oder zu verbergen. Sie sind transparent, da der Endserver die wahre IP-Adresse des Nutzers sehen kann. Sie werden beispielsweise in Unternehmen und Bildungseinrichtungen für Content-Filtering und Caching eingesetzt.
    2. Anonyme Proxys verbergen die IP-Adresse des Nutzers vor den Zielservern. Sie sind nützlich für Benutzer, die anonym bleiben möchten. Allerdings ist keine vollständige Anonymität gewährleistet, da der Proxy selbst die ursprüngliche IP-Adresse kennt.
    3. Distorting Proxys geben eine falsche IP-Adresse an die Zielseite weiter, was sie eine Stufe anonymisierter als anonyme Proxys macht. Sie werden verwendet, um Geo-Location-Einschränkungen zu umgehen und mehr Anonymität zu bieten.
    4. High-Anonymity (Elite) Proxys bieten das höchste Maß an Anonymität. Sie verbergen sowohl die Tatsache, dass ein Proxy verwendet wird, als auch die ursprüngliche IP-Adresse des Nutzers. Sie eignen sich für Benutzer, die ihre Online-Aktivitäten komplett privat halten möchten.
    5. Reverse Proxys: Im Gegensatz zu den meisten anderen Varianten, die auf der Clientseite sitzen, werden Reverse Proxys auf der Serverseite eingesetzt. Sie leiten Anfragen an einen oder mehrere Server weiter und können für Lastverteilung, Caching, SSL-Verschlüsselung und als Sicherheitsmaßnahme dienen.
    6. SOCKS Proxys sind tiefer in der Netzwerkebene verankert und nicht nur auf HTTP-Verkehr beschränkt, sondern können jede Art von Netzwerkverkehr übertragen. SOCKS Proxys sind beliebt für Anwendungen, die einen höheren Grad an Sicherheit oder das Umgehen von Firewalls benötigen.

    Welche Vor- und Nachteile gibt es?

    Die Verwendung von Proxy-Servern kann Vor- und Nachteile haben. Die Wahl, ob und welcher Proxy-Server verwendet werden sollte, hängt stark von den spezifischen Anforderungen, dem Kontext und den Sicherheitsbedürfnissen ab.

    Vorteile:

    • Proxys können als Sicherheitsbarriere dienen, indem sie den direkten Zugriff auf ein Netzwerk verhindern und potenziell schädlichen Datenverkehr filtern.
    • Sie können die IP-Adresse des Nutzers verbergen, was die Anonymität erhöht und es schwieriger macht, Online-Aktivitäten zu verfolgen.
    • Mit einem Proxy-Server in einem anderen Land können Nutzer regionale Einschränkungen umgehen und auf Inhalte zugreifen, die in ihrem eigenen Land möglicherweise nicht verfügbar sind.
    • Proxys können häufig angeforderte Ressourcen zwischenspeichern, was die Ladezeiten für wiederholte Anfragen reduziert und die Bandbreitennutzung verringert.
    • In Unternehmensumgebungen ermöglichen Proxys die Überwachung und Kontrolle des Mitarbeiter-Internetzugangs, was zur Durchsetzung von Richtlinien und zur Verhinderung unangemessener Nutzung beitragen kann.

    Nachteile:

    • Die zusätzliche Verarbeitung und Weiterleitung durch den Proxy kann die Internetgeschwindigkeit reduzieren, insbesondere wenn der genutzte Server überlastet oder geografisch weit entfernt ist.
    • Ein schlecht konfigurierter oder unsicherer Proxy kann ein Sicherheitsrisiko darstellen, da sämtlicher Datenverkehr durch ihn geleitet wird. Dies kann zu Datenschutzverletzungen führen, wenn der Server kompromittiert wird.
    • Einige Proxys verschlüsseln den Datenverkehr nicht vollständig, was zu Sicherheitslücken führen kann, insbesondere bei sensiblen Daten.
    • Nicht alle Anwendungen und Dienste unterstützen die Nutzung von Proxys, was zu Konnektivitäts- oder Funktionalitätsproblemen führen kann.
    • Einige Proxys, insbesondere transparente und einfache anonyme Proxys, bieten keine vollständige Anonymität, da sie möglicherweise Informationen über den Ursprung der Anfrage preisgeben.
    DoS, DDoS und RDoS – Was sind die Unterschiede?
    Warnung: DDoS-Erpresserbande Kadyrovtsy attackiert deutsche Ziele
    X